Lions Gate Bridge, Vancouver Panoramic

After a long hike around the Stanley Park Seawall, we decided to take a high resolution panorama looking north in Vancouver by the Lions Gate Bridge from Prospect Point. The photo is a joint effort by Steve and myself. The original contains 15 photos at 21 megapixels each stitched together to create the final composition.

Climb up the Grouse Grind, Vancouver

Yesterday, Steve and I decided to challenge ourselves to the Grouse Grind climb in North Vancouver. Having never done this climb, we were well aware of what we were getting ourselves into. The 2800 foot vertical climb was more challenging than we had anticipated, especially since we decided to both carry heavy backpacks up the trail full of camera gear!

Once at the top, the struggles were well worth the effort as the views were breath-taking and the sense of accomplishment was high. Tired and sweaty, we vowed to replace every calorie that we just burnt with an amazing plate of nachos and beer!
